IWC seeks a Dental Assistant for part time hours to work across all areas of their accredited Dental Service. ABOUT IWC: IWC is an Aboriginal community-controlled and multi-accredited health and wellbeing organisation that delivers services without discrimination to Indigenous and non-Indigenous peoples in Bundaberg and the Wide Bay Burnett. FIRST NATIONS PERSONS ARE ENCOURAGED TO IDENTIFY THEIR MOB IN THEIR RESUME OR COVER LETTER ABOUT THE POSITION: IWC have an exciting opportunity for a Dental Assistant to join their team. The Dental Assistant may also be required to cover Reception duties and Sterilisation as required. Key Responsibilities: Patient care and management. High standards of infection control. Maintaining a clean and safe clinical environment. Process and organize lab jobs and x-rays. Previous experience in a dental practice environment is essential. Proficient in keyboard skills and basic knowledge of MS Word and Excel and at least one Dental software program. Skills and Attributes: High standard of infections control and safe clinical practices. Initiative and flexibility. Strong ability to learn new skills and systems quickly. High level of confidentiality. KEY REQUIREMENTS: Certificate III in Dental Assisting is desired. A current driver's licence is essential or ability to obtain. A First Aid Certificate or ability to obtain. A Blue Card (Working with Children Card QLD)* or ability to obtain. A Federal Police Check or ability to obtain. * No Card, No Start legislation means that the successful applicant will need to hold a valid blue card before they start work. IWC will cover the cost of this application for the successful candidate. SALARY PACKAGE: Your Salary Package is made up of the following: - Salary Sacrifice Packaging valued up to $15,990 per annum – adding approximately $2,000 to your take-home pay (available after completion of probation). Meals and Entertainment Package up to $2,600 per annum (available after completion of probation). Early finish on Fridays. Superannuation valued at 11%. Annual Leave Loading of 17.5%.
